About Us

SMEC is a global engineering, management and development consultancy delivering innovative solutions for our clients and partners. Leveraging our 70-year history of delivering nation-building infrastructure, we provide technical expertise and advanced engineering services to resolve complex challenges across major infrastructure and energy projects.

SMEC has a long and proud history which dates back to Australia’s iconic Snowy Mountains Hydroelectric Scheme in 1949, one of the largest and most complex hydroelectric schemes in the world. Headquartered in Australia, we have offices across more than 35 countries in Oceania, Southeast Asia, South Asia, Africa and the Americas. Together with our clients and partners, we deliver projects that directly contribute to improving health, quality of life and development outcomes for communities and neighborhoods around the world. Driven by innovation, ingenuity and skill, our people have shaped these outcomes in some of the world’s most remote and challenging environments.

Since 2016, SMEC has been a member of the Surbana Jurong Group, an Asia-based global powerhouse of over 16,000 employees. Through our network of global specialists and by collaborating with local partners, we connect clients with the best teams and capabilities to deliver sustainable solutions.
